Output 8fa1df93c9e58229b01a3efc83635a20c648f6ed8b1daac54378389028630a63:15

value
27872418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0208133bbe693b8135753d8067a17917c093bb88 OP_EQUAL
address
M85uFtDAXaxb87Vx3yNC856sHD9DxdFHqy
transaction
8fa1df93c9e58229b01a3efc83635a20c648f6ed8b1daac54378389028630a63
spent
true